Calathea Zebrina, named for its bold zebra-striped leaves, is one of the larger Calathea varieties, capable of reaching a height of three feet as a houseplant. As the bright green leaves unfurl, Calathea Zebrina begins to resemble a miniature clump of striped banana plants. This plant is a must-have for anyone looking to bring a tropical atmosphere into the home.

Care

When growing Calathea Zebrina, consider their natural habitat. Native to the understory of tropical rainforests in South America, Calathea Zebrina requires high levels of humidity, and they dislike bright direct sunlight. Brown leaf edges are a sign of low humidity or too much light. Fertilizer is important for Calathea Zebrina. We recommend diluting a general houseplant fertilizer by about half and applying monthly throughout the spring and summer.

Light

As an understory plant, Calathea Zebrina will not tolerate bright direct sunlight for very long. However, very low light conditions will slow down the growth of the plant and increases the chance that overwatering will occur since the plant will be using less water. Moderate indirect light is ideal to encourage steady growth.

Water

Calathea Zebrina likes consistently moist soil, however it is important that the soil and pot is well draining and that the roots are not sitting in a pool of water. Leaves will curl and crisp when the plant is not receiving adequate moisture.
